Let
k
be a nonnegative integer, and let
m
k
=
4
(
k
+
1
)
(
k
+
3
)
k
2
+
6
k
+
6
. We prove that every simple graph with maximum average degree less than
m
k
decomposes into a forest and a subgraph with maximum degree at most
k
(furthermore, when
k
≤
3
both subgraphs can be required to be forests). It follows that every simple graph with maximum average degree less than
m
k
has game coloring number at most
4
+
k
.
